WebExplanation: The correct equation for the new Z co-ordinate if an object undergoes 3D rotation around x axis is – Znew = Yold x sinθ + Zold x cosθ. When the matrix form for 3D rotation around x axis is expanded then we get the following equations – Xnew = Xold; Ynew = Yold x cosθ – Zold x sinθ; Znew = Yold x sinθ + Zold x cosθ. WebThere is no unique choice for the rotation if you only have only one moving point (x0,y0,z0). Allowing both translation and rotation makes it even more trivial: you can always bring a single start point (x0,y0,z0) to a new point (x1, y1, z1) by applying a simple translation t=(x1-x0,y1-y0,z1-z0) without doing any rotation at all.
